The case for solar

Why Filipino homes and businesses are switching

Substantially lower bills

Generate your own electricity during the day and cut a large share of your monthly Meralco bill — for decades, not just a few years.

Protection from rising rates

Philippine electricity is among the most expensive in Southeast Asia and keeps climbing. Producing your own power shields you from future increases.

Backup during brownouts

Add battery storage and keep your essential appliances running when the grid goes down — a real advantage in areas with frequent outages.

Energy independence

Rely less on the grid year after year with clean power produced right on your own roof.

Clean, renewable energy

Reduce your carbon footprint using the abundant, year-round sunshine the Philippines receives nationwide.

A long-term asset

A quality solar installation is a lasting investment that can add value and appeal to your property.

Solar Potential in the Philippines

The Philippines receives strong, consistent solar potential nationwide — a typical 1kWp solar system here produces approximately 1,435 kWh per year on average, making solar a reliable investment regardless of exact location.

4.73

kWh/m²/day

Average solar irradiation nationwide

3.93

kWh/kWp/day

Average PV system output (~1,435 kWh/year per installed kWp)

3.24–4.55

kWh/kWp/day

Country range depending on location

Solar potential data: Global Photovoltaic Power Potential study, World Bank Group / ESMAP / Solargis (globalsolaratlas.info)

Net metering

Turn your extra daytime power into bill credits

Under the Philippines' net metering program, a grid-tied solar system can export the energy you don't use during the day back to the grid, earning credits against what you draw at night. It's a key part of what makes solar pay off here.

The application is filed with your distribution utility. Most customers apply themselves, and we're glad to point you in the right direction — or, if you'd rather not deal with the paperwork, we can prepare and file it for you as an optional service.
